## Changelog — Build agent clock sync defaults

We changed the default time-sync settings on the Forgeline build agents after clock skew between agents caused cache invalidation and out-of-order artifact timestamps. Sync interval is now much shorter and agents refuse to start jobs if drift exceeds the new threshold. New contractors: you don't need to configure anything manually; images ship with these values baked in. The updated defaults are listed below.

config for haweg-bagag:
[kasath]
host = kasath.qirvancorp.internal
user = kasath_svc
database = kasath_prod

Ticket #— Floor 9 Opening Prep, Brindlemoor House

Hi facilities folks, Floor 9 opens to staff next Monday and we need a few things squared away before then. Lift access is live, but the two side doors by the kitchenette are still on the old lock config — please reprogram them before Friday. Also, signage for the quiet rooms hasn't arrived, so pop up the temporary printed ones for now. Until the badge readers sync, the interim door code for Floor 9 is below.

door code, bajop-bajog: bdg-DSWAC-43621

## Turnstile Upgrade

The lobby turnstiles at Medlar Court were replaced over the summer with faster optical gates. Tap your badge flat against the reader rather than waving it; the new sensors read on contact only. If a gate rejects your badge twice, step aside and use the manual gate by the desk. The manual gate requires this entry code:

door code, yagap-bahof: bdg-O-05

Runbook: connection pooling for the Tarnwick orders database. When reviewing changes to pool settings, check that max connections across all replicas stays under the database's hard cap, including headroom for migrations and ad-hoc admin sessions. Idle timeout should remain shorter than the load balancer's connection reaper or we get stale-socket errors at low traffic. Reject any PR that hardcodes pool sizes in application code rather than config. The current production pool runs with the values below.

service settings:
novath:
  pin: 1396
  tenant: pelys
  seal: seal_ccc035e1
  metrics_host: metrics.novath.qorvelworks.test
  standby_team: fraeth
  escalation: drueth-zorok
  nonce: 61d508